Cycling the Surrey Hills takes you along steep-banked country lanes, through ancient woodland, past pretty villages and well-kept pubs. Cycle Surrey Hills is a network of over 80km of off-road cycling trails in South West Surrey where you can get active, improve fitness and experience the spectacular scenery of the Surrey Hills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ty (AONB).
